1. Sandy Pines Campground
Sandy Pines is the quintessential Maine camping site that is the best blend of camping with a little luxury. With a deep sea swimming pool, family-oriented activities, and expansive premises, this is the location to opt for a weekend escape or make it your seasonal outdoor camping area.

The campground supplies standard recreational vehicle and tent websites in addition to glamping spaces like teepees, Airstream trailers (Breeze or Wayfarer), Chuck Wagon, and Conestoga wagons. Every one of these glamping spaces featured genuine beds and electrical power, quirky style, warmed floors, exterior dining areas, and a lot of area.

Situated in the charming seaside town of Kennebunkport, this camping site has a classic vibe that will promptly deliver you to a simpler time. It's additionally within a short drive of Goose Rocks Beach, which is just one of the most attractive coastlines in Maine.

2. Savage River Lodge
Traveling west along I-68 in northwestern Maryland is a picturesque experience. The highway goes across the engineering wonder referred to as Sideling Hillside, and passes by enchanting primary streets and home town diners.

Stashed in the middle of Savage River State Forest, the lodge's 18 cabins were handcrafted from white want and feature genuine chinking. The cabins are a good alternative for romantic vacations, unique household vacations and rustic team outings.

In 2014, the center expanded its offerings with 8 glamping yurts. The one-of-a-kind lodgings were designed and developed by Pacific Yurts. They offer king-sized beds, radiant flooring heating and domed skylights. The yurts do not allow family pets, which may make them a much better alternative for tourists with allergic reactions. The home is taken care of by Fronterra Resources, which also runs the Cornucopia Cafe restaurant, Little Crossings Cupboard & Grant's Mercantile in Frostburg and Casselman View Home getaway leasing.

3. Governors Island
Glampers can enjoy the island's soothing setting with a variety of outside tasks. The expansive bucolic room, which was once an armed forces base, has actually turned into a metropolitan play ground and cultural destination.

It's a fast and inexpensive ferry adventure from Manhattan or Brooklyn, with boats departing the Battery Maritime Structure in Lower Manhattan and Brooklyn Bridge Park on the weekend breaks. The 172-acre island is car-free, features parks and restaurants, art installments, historic monuments, and world-class sights.

Site visitors can spend the day exploring Castle William and Fort Jay, and glampers can appreciate the sundown from their tent, which has breathtaking home windows. Afterward, guests can relax in their king bed with its deluxe quilt and 1500-thread count sheets. Then, they can wake up to a sight of the Statuary of Liberty.
